Follow the below steps to link tasks in microsoft project:
- On the View tab, in the Task Views group, click Gantt Chart.
- In the Task Name field, select two or more tasks you want to link, in the order you want to link them.
- On the Task tab, in the Schedule group, click the Link Tasks button.
- Project creates a finish-to-start task link by default. You can change this task link to start-to-start, finish-to-finish, or start-to-finish.

I am reading your question to be that you want to the link the summary tasks together.
This is possible in Project but not recommended. Linking summary tasks may cause circular relationships which in turn, corrupt Project files.
In addition, the subtasks are where work is occurring and should be where the relationships between the work packages should be defined
that being said, you can link discontiguous tasks by selecting the first task (predecessor) , press and hold down your Control key to select the successor task. Release the Control key and click the Link tasks button.
